PENETRATING DAMP

Problems like defective downpipes or guttering, blocked cavity walls, porous brickwork and broken or loose roof tiles are external factors that can cause penetrating damp. Inside a structure, it can be triggered by burst or dripping pipework, cracked shower trays and overflowing bathtubs or sinks. If left unchecked, walls and woodwork can be seriously affected, and the sure signs of this will be damp, dark patches on walls, peeling or bubbling paintwork and blistered or broken plaster.

Roofing timbers which are continually damp because of a leaky roof, can be affected by wet rot if this is not treated. Even though it doesn't spread into your brickwork, wet rot can cause the timber in your roof to become structurally unsound, and in the worst case scenario you may even need to have a new roof installed - extremely costly! Wet rot can be identified by the appearance of black fungus on your woodwork and a "spongy" feel to the wood, along with a distinctive musty smell from the decaying wood.

The measures for prevention can be quite basic, for example repointing unsound brickwork, inspecting pipework for leaks and cleaning your gutters & roof and checking for leaks. CONDENSATION

Condensation Damp Alsager UK (01270)

Many properties in Alsager have problems with condensation, and this is among the most common reasons for damp. When colder surfaces make contact with warm, moist air, tiny droplets of water form on those cold surfaces. It's often caused because of inadequate ventilation in places where there's high humidity, i.e. kitchens, boiler rooms and bathrooms.

To avoid condensation issues, easy strategies include ensuring that you have adequate ventilation in the main trouble spots, and wiping away any droplets whenever they arise. This might call for the upgrading or installation of extractor fans, air bricks and cooker hoods to help remove the moisture laden air outside of your house.

With some homes moist air can be sucked in from the outside, plainly making matters worse. RISING DAMP

A damp proof course has been fitted as standard on homes built in Great Britain since 1875. You may not have a damp course installed on your home or property in Alsager if it was constructed earlier than this. If your property was constructed after this year, but you are still experiencing rising damp, it may be that the damp proof membrane has been compromised.

It can be hard to distinguish rising damp, nevertheless some giveaway indications are; tide marks on walls, crumbling or rotten skirting boards and white powdery deposits being discovered on floor surfaces or appearing on walls. It's possible that you might have a rising damp problem if you have noticed one or more of these.

Rising Damp Alsager Cheshire

The initial step towards solving your problems with rising damp should simply be to check whether or not you have a DPM on the external walls of your home in Alsager. For adequate protection it should be 150mm (about 6") above ground level. If this is not the case you can dig the ground away to create this space, or if this isn't feasible, you can put in a higher damp course.

If this isn't the cause of the problem and your damp proof membrane is installed and in order, there could be more serious issues to resolve caused by the dampness rising up from the ground, through your floors, and into the walls of your home.

A damp proofing cream (such as Permaguard) can be injected into your walls if you have a somewhat older home with no damp proof course, or one that is damaged over a wide area. Holes are drilled at intervals in the mortar course, and a special nozzle is used to inject the cream, which then penetrates into the surrounding brickwork before curing to create an effective, horizontal water-repelling barrier.

In instances where damp proofing cream injection isn't an appropriate remedy, or when your membrane is seriously damaged, installing a complete new damp proof course may be neccessary. Although this is obviously a fairly extreme approach, it might be the best way to remedy your rising damp problems in an effective way.

Another potential remedy for smaller areas of damage may include painting with a bitumen based, waterproof latex emulsion. This has to be applied under your current floor coverings, so tiles, carpets and wood flooring will need to be lifted prior to work being done. Also used as an integral part of the tanking procedure to make a room watertight, this is a particularly effectual treatment in cellars. For added protection in those troublesome areas, your Alsager damp proof specialist may suggest the laying of building paper (a specialist foil backed membrane) before the bitumen paint has completely dried out.

Tanking: In areas of a house that are below ground, like cellars or basements, "tanking" is a process where surfaces that are exposed are painted with a watertight coating. All wall coverings and plaster must be taken off and the surfaces prepared correctly before the commencement of any work, because this waterproof coating must be applied on the base surface of floors and walls. Once the coating has been applied and is dry, it is then the time to replaster and decorate over the top. Because it has to be applied to an entire ground floor or basement level of a building, this is a very disruptive process. SOLVING DAMP WITH A DEHUMIDIFIER

To help with condensation issues, you could try using dehumidifiers, which for lowering the moisture content of the air, are very efficient. The downside with the use of dehumidifiers in endeavouring to stop dampness is that they only alleviate the cause of the damp, not cure it. Some of the Benefits of Using Dehumidifiers

Presented below are some positive aspects of dehumidifier usage:

  1. Protects Belongings and Property Structure: By preventing damp-related issues and safeguarding belongings from moisture damage, lower humidity levels ensure the structural integrity of the premises is maintained.
  2. Odour Reduction: Removes musty odours linked to elevated humidity levels, resulting in a more refreshing and pleasant living space.
  3. Improvements in Health: Dehumidifiers contribute to lowering humidity levels, which in turn reduces the proliferation of mould and dust mites, allergens known to exacerbate allergies and asthma and lead to respiratory problems.
  4. Comfort Levels: By lowering humidity levels, the indoor atmosphere becomes cooler and more pleasant, thus improving the living conditions for residents.
  5. Energy Efficiency: Heating systems are inclined to operate more efficiently with the assistance of some dehumidifiers, which dry out the air, making it easier to heat and thus saving energy.

Keep an eye out for membership of and qualifications from bodies such as the DPA (Damp Proofing Association) or the Property Care Association (PCA), or contractors holding the Certificated Surveyor in Remedial Treatments (CSRT) or the Certificated Surveyor of Timber and Dampness qualifications.

You can be sure that your damp proofing provider is properly qualified and has the appropriate working experience to perform a first class damp proof service, if they are members of either the DPA or PCA. Any damp proofing work undertaken by one of their members also comes with a guarantee.

Woodworm Treatment and Prevention Alsager

Unfortunately, woodworm is a common issue that can affect buildings of any age. The larvae of certain kinds of beetles gnaw away at the wood, which can lead to significant damage over time. Nonetheless, there are a number of steps that you can take to prevent woodworm infestations and treat any pre-existing issues.

The first step in treating woodworm is to identify the kind of woodworm present, since different species call for different treatment methods. This is best done by a woodworm specialist, who can also evaluate the scope of the infestation and recommend the most appropriate treatment.

One effective woodworm treatment technique is the use of insecticides, which can be applied in liquid or gel form. This kind of treatment is especially effective for small infestations, but may not be suitable for more serious cases. For larger or more severe infestations, fumigation might be necessary. This involves sealing-off the affected area and discharging a gas into the space to kill off the larvae. Fumigation is a much more invasive treatment option and requires specialist training and equipment, therefore it's important to call in a qualified professional.

Prevention is also the key to avoiding woodworm infestations in the future. This can be accomplished through routine inspections, maintaining good ventilation and humidity levels, and treating any existing woodworm as soon as it's identified.

Positive Input Ventilation (PIV)

Positive Input Ventilation (PIV) may be the perfect solution to reduce damp issues within your house in Alsager. If you have noticed damp and mould inside your dwelling or condensation around your windows then Positive Input Ventilation can help to reduce the humidity. It accomplishes this by continuously circulating fresh air. This steady refresh and replacement of the air inside your property increases air quality, reduces pollutants and odours and has been proven to improve the day to day life of allergy and asthma sufferers by reducing the number of dust mite allergens. Some considerations for PIV systems is that they work better when installed in a loft space, and your dwelling does have to be reasonably airtight. Air, just like water, takes the path of least resistance, and any spaces and gaps around doors or windows will let the fresh air get out, whilst bringing possible contaminated air in.

Condensation Control Alsager

Control of condensation is crucial for maintaining a pleasant and healthy indoor environment. When warm, moist air meets colder surfaces, condensation takes place and leads to the formation of water droplets. Mould growth, damage to building materials, and a decline in indoor air quality can occur as a consequence of uncontrolled condensation.

Adequate ventilation plays a crucial role in controlling condensation by regulating humidity levels and promoting air circulation. Reduction of condensation and temperature differentials can be attained by using insulation and double-glazing. Effective condensation management enables the prevention of potential problems and the creation of a more pleasant living or working environment.

Reducing temperature differentials and minimising condensation are two things that double-glazed windows and insulation can help with. Insulation serves as a barrier between cold surfaces and moist, warm air, preventing them from coming into direct contact. When the temperature difference is reduced, condensation is less likely to form on surfaces like ceilings, windows and walls. Double-glazed windows with two panes of glass and an insulating layer between are effective at maintaining a uniform interior temperature, which further inhibits condensation.

Another technique for effective condensation control involves addressing moisture sources directly. Moisture is released into the air by activities like showering, cooking and drying clothes indoors. Exhaust fans and good ventilation in kitchens and bathrooms can prevent excessive humidity buildup. Maintaining acceptable indoor humidity levels in areas susceptible to high moisture content is possible with the use of dehumidifiers.
